Scholarship Applications Now Available - Please share! Each year, the Charles City Rotary Club awards scholarships for up to two outstanding high school graduating seniors based on their scholastic, extracurricular and community activities and achievements.
Applications are available from the high school guidance counselor’s office or downloaded here
Please complete and return the application prior to 1:00 PM at the High School Counselor’s Office or by 1:00 PM on April 29, 2023, to Mark Wicks at the Charles City Area Chamber of Commerce, 401 N. Main St., or email to mark@charlescitychamber.com.
Recipients will be announced on Class Day and honored at the annual Rotary “Pass the Buck Night” on June 26.
